WebSep 10, 2024 · Blood pressure medications: Astragalus can lower blood pressure. 9 It could cause dangerously low blood pressure if combined … WebOct 22, 2014 · Background: Astragalus (Radix Astragali, huang qi) is the dried root of Astragalus membranaceus (Fisch.) Bge. var. mongholicus (Bge.) Hsiao or Astragalus membranaceus (Fisch.) Bge. (Family Leguminosae). It is one of the most widely used herbs in traditional Chinese medicine for treating kidney diseases.
